Market Overview
The global market for storefront glass, which encompasses specialized glazing systems for retail and commercial building facades, is projected to expand significantly, rising from USD 9.97 billion in 2025 to USD 16.87 billion by 2031, demonstrating a compound annual growth rate of 9.16%. These systems are crucial for ensuring transparency, security, and environmental regulation within these structures. This robust growth is primarily fueled by the ongoing expansion of commercial infrastructure and stringent energy regulations that necessitate superior thermal performance. Such demands create a steady need for sophisticated glazing solutions, independent of transient design trends, with nonresidential building spending expected to increase by over 7% in 2024, as reported by the American Institute of Architects, highlighting strong construction sector demand.
Despite this promising outlook, the market's expansion is considerably hampered by unpredictable raw material and energy costs. Price instability for essential components like float glass and aluminum can severely impact profit margins and cause project delays. This volatility represents a substantial hurdle to the sustained growth and operational stability of the storefront glass industry, posing a formidable challenge to its otherwise positive trajectory.
Market Driver
The primary driving force behind the storefront glass market is the worldwide growth of the retail sector alongside extensive modernization efforts. With brick-and-mortar stores increasingly focusing on enhancing customer experience and brand prominence, there's a heightened need for transparent and aesthetically pleasing glazing systems designed to optimize natural light and product display. This impetus is reinforced by the ongoing renovation of older commercial buildings to meet modern design specifications, thereby increasing the demand for advanced frameless and high-clarity glass solutions. The National Retail Federation’s '2024 Retail Sales Forecast' from March 2024 predicted a 2.5% to 3.5% increase in retail sales for 2024, reaching about $5.28 trillion, indicating that this sustained retail growth directly fuels investment in facade upgrades and new store developments, guaranteeing consistent demand for advanced storefront installations.
Simultaneously, the escalating requirement for energy-efficient building enclosures and the enforcement of stringent green building codes are significantly influencing industry needs. Regulatory bodies and environmental certifications now necessitate high-performance glazing to reduce thermal transfer and mitigate carbon emissions, pushing manufacturers towards innovations like low-emissivity and vacuum-insulated glass. For instance, Vitro Architectural Glass reported in April 2024 that its architectural glass products achieved a Global Warming Potential of 1,240 kilograms of CO2 equivalent, which is 13% below the industry standard, showcasing advancements in sustainability. This marked transition towards sustainable, high-value materials is reflected in financial results across the sector, with Apogee Enterprises' Architectural Framing Systems segment reporting net sales of $133.2 million in its June 2024 'Fiscal 2025 First Quarter Results', underscoring substantial ongoing investment in commercial fenestration systems.
Market Challenge
A significant hindrance to the global storefront glass market's growth is the unpredictable nature of raw material and energy expenses. Unstable pricing for essential inputs, including float glass and aluminum, makes it challenging for manufacturers and glazing contractors to offer consistent pricing for extended projects. This unpredictability forces companies to absorb rising costs to stay competitive, subsequently squeezing profit margins and limiting capital available for business expansion. As a result, the difficulty in accurately predicting costs frequently leads to project delays or cancellations, as developers are compelled to re-evaluate financial feasibility.
This issue is especially critical due to the industry’s dependence on energy-intensive manufacturing processes and metal framing. An abrupt escalation in material costs can severely disrupt the supply chain, making it difficult for suppliers to fulfill existing contracts without incurring substantial financial losses. For example, the Associated General Contractors of America reported in August 2025 that aluminum mill shape prices saw a 22.8 percent year-over-year increase. Such sharp rises in core material expenses foster a risky operational environment where financial uncertainties often eclipse potential benefits, consequently impeding the market's overall progress.
Market Trends
A significant trend transforming retail facades is the integration of electrochromic smart glass, which offers dynamic control over privacy and transparency. Diverging from conventional static glazing that primarily focuses on insulation, this innovative technology empowers store operators to instantly transition glass from transparent to opaque. This allows for the creation of on-demand private areas, such as fitting rooms, or the concealment of interior displays after business hours. This functionality considerably boosts the adaptability of storefronts, expanding their role from mere product visibility to sophisticated active environment management. Gauzy Ltd. reported in June 2025, within their 'Gauzy Ltd. Celebrates One Year as Public Company' press release, fiscal year 2024 revenues of $103.5 million, representing a 33% increase, which was largely driven by the accelerated adoption of their smart glass technologies across the architectural and safety sectors.
Concurrently, the market is undergoing a crucial transition towards incorporating recycled and low-carbon glass materials to mitigate resource scarcity and align with circular economy objectives. Manufacturers are increasingly replacing new raw materials with substantial amounts of cullet, or recycled glass, a practice that lowers the embodied carbon footprint of the final product and decreases energy consumption during the manufacturing process. This emerging trend emphasizes the material's provenance and its overall lifecycle impact, moving beyond solely focusing on thermal performance attributes. For example, GlassBalkan reported in October 2025 that Saint-Gobain's ORAÉ glass substrate now features up to 64% recycled content, as detailed in the article 'Saint-Gobain Glass Shortlisted for IOM3 Sustainable Future Award 2025', substantially reducing its carbon footprint compared to standard float glass production.
